Q: Is 178,911,378 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 178,911,378 is not a prime number.

Why is 178,911,378 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 178911378 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 9 18 9,939,521 19,879,042 29,818,563 59,637,126 89,455,689 and 178,911,378, with no remainder.

Since 178,911,378 cannot be divided by just 1 and 178,911,378, it is not a prime number.
